Abstract Recently, the increasing demand causes the general trend to upgrade the existing power system instead of building up a new one due to environmental regulation and restrained sources. Flexible AC Transmission Systems (FACTS) devices play the main role in improving performance of the power system and reach optimum utilization of the existing power system without adding new transmission lines. Moreover they can be used to solve dynamic and steady state problems of the power system. This thesis determines the optimal location and size of different types of FACTS devices which are Thyristor Controlled Series Capacitor (TCSC) and Static Var Compensator (SVC) or Static synchronous Compensator (STATCOM).The TCSC is selected to control the power flow and to ensure that no transmission lines exceed its thermal limits, while the SVC and STATCOM are selected to support system voltage.The performance and the investment cost of SATCOM and SVC are compared at different loading conditions to decide which type is most efficient. The main objectives are minimize the total active power losses, minimize the voltage deviations and minimize the investment cost of the devices considering the ordinary load flow constraints and system limits, the problem is formulated for steady-state studies |
